Julien Gauthier and the Ottawa Senators are keeping their hopes up that it will be a case of third time lucky in the NHL.
“It’s a great feeling,” Gauthier said, speaking with reporters in Boston. “I’ve been wanting a fresh start, a good opportunity and I’m happy to get it here.”A former junior teammate of fellow Senators Thomas Chabot and Mathieu Joseph, he was originally drafted by the Carolina Hurricanes in the first round of the 2016 NHL draft .
“I’m a big guy that skates pretty fast, I shoot the puck hard, I finish my checks and a try to play a two-way game,” Gauthier said in offering up a scouting effort of his own style. “It facilitates things,” Gauthier said of his relationship with Joseph and Chabot. “I’ve known these guys for a long time. We see each other in the summer. It’s fun for me because they can show me around and introduce me to the guys more easily, so I’m happy about that.”
